Product Description:
The KSM02.1B-071C-35N-S1-HG2-ET-SD-D7-NN-FW is a motor-integrated servo drive manufactured by Bosch Rexroth Indramat and positioned within the KSM Motor Integrated Servo Drives series. It is series 2 and design version 1, with a standard design option for direct machine mounting on decentralized machine sections. By combining the motor, power electronics, and communication interfaces in one housing, it reduces the number of separate components needed at the axis and supports compact machine layouts. This layout is suited to packaging equipment, transfer modules, and other machines where the drive must be mounted close to moving assemblies.
Electrical energy is provided by a DC 750 V intermediate circuit, and heat is removed solely by natural convection, so the housing operates without forced airflow. Power, feedback, and Ethernet conductors share a Hybrid Connector, which helps keep external wiring compact in tight spaces. Position data reach the drive through a Hiperface optical encoder that delivers 128 signal periods per revolution while maintaining single-turn tracking. A plain shaft with a shaft seal transfers torque, and an electrically released holding brake engages when control voltage is absent. The motor section uses winding code 35 and length code C, which match the physical format of this integrated axis unit.
System coordination occurs over Multi-Ethernet, enabling communication with SERCOS III, EtherNet/IP, PROFINET, or EtherCAT controllers. This protocol flexibility lets the same integrated drive package work with different control platforms. Functional safety is provided by Safe Motion with SBC, allowing safe torque-off and safe stop functions without external relays. The mechanical envelope corresponds to Motor Size 071, giving a balance between inertia and continuous torque for mid-range axes, and brake holding power is supplied at DC 24 V.
